Weekend Box-Office 9/4-9/7....All about another crap movie debuting at #1
Weekend estimates based on boxoffice.com I just don't get number #1. Is this the lowest rated movie on RT to debut in the top spot?? Please PLEASE let "Inglorious Basterds" sneak back into the top spot!!!
1 All About Steve $14,000,000 -- 2,251 -- $6,219 $14,000,000 1 Fox
2 Inglourious Basterds $13,800,000 -35% 3,358 +193 $4,110 $93,995,607 3 The Weinstein Company
3 The Final Destination $13,700,000 -54% 3,121 0 $4,390 $48,909,007 2 Warner Bros./ New Line
4 Gamer $10,300,000 -- 2,502 0 $4,117 $10,300,000 1 Lionsgate
5 District 9 $8,500,000 -25% 3,139 -41 $2,708 $103,774,121 4 Sony/ TriStar
6 Julie & Julia $6,800,000 -12% 2,503 +40 $2,716 $80,440,394 5 Sony/ Columbia
7 G.I. Joe: The Rise of Cobra $6,500,000 -22% 2,846 -621 $2,284 $140,815,730 5 Paramount
8 Halloween 2 $6,200,000 -64% 3,088 +63 $2,008 $26,255,892 2 The Weinstein Company
9 Extract $5,800,000 -- 1,611 -- $3,600 $5,800,000 1 Miramax
10 The Time Traveler's Wife $5,000,000 -29% 2,803 -158 $1,784 $55,341,923 4 Warner Bros./ New Line
